你查询的IP:[119.80.95.119]  地理位置:中国–北京–北京

最新查询117.60.135.68 118.144.22.55 119.32.214.61 218.104.53.40 124.72.240.198 58.192.62.181 118.24.36.132 119.42.55.210 116.60.37.227 119.80.95.119 203.161.192.171 203.92.160.206 220.192.9.254 202.173.8.159 203.95.96.162 119.42.224.230 219.244.186.134 202.165.208.208 202.10.64.34 124.29.98.54 203.90.2.25 125.171.37.145 61.29.128.126 121.40.104.187 61.29.128.182 123.242.168.139 123.249.253.142 210.32.127.180 123.176.80.184 202.38.81.91 125.208.22.171